Joseph Byrne was transported on the James Pattison, departing 2nd Oct 1829 and arriving 20th Jan 1830 with 201 passengers.

Irish Convict Database, by Peter Mayberry. Joseph Byrne, alias Burn, age on arrival, 16, per James Pattison (1) 1830, Tried 1829, at Dublin, 7 years, for Stealing brass fender, DOB, 1815, Native place, Dublin, Single, Catholic, Blacksmiths apprentice.
